This is one of our nicest parks Lee County has to offer. It's dog friendly, which is great!!! To use the doggy park you will need to register and pay a minimal fee yearly. Tho, you can walk your dog on a leash on the walking, running, jogging, bicycling path.

★★★★★ — Jacqueline , Mar 2024

Well maintained park on the water. The dog park has a "membership" requirement. It has two sides both with ample seating and shade. Dogs are not allowed on trails. The trails are along water and anytime water is wet in Fl, there are gators. There is a butterfly atrium and garden with scheduled tours.
